Overview of Texas Instruments LM4041DQDBZT
The LM4041DQDBZT from Texas Instruments is a precision micropower shunt voltage reference that offers the flexibility of a programmable output voltage and excellent temperature stability. This product is designed for a wide range of applications, including portable battery-powered equipment, power supplies, and instrumentation systems.
Key Features
- Adjustable Output: The LM4041DQDBZT provides an output voltage that can be set to any value between 1.225V and 10V using external resistors. This feature allows designers to customize the output voltage to meet specific application requirements.
- High Accuracy: With an initial accuracy of ±0.1% and a temperature coefficient of just 100 ppm/°C, this voltage reference ensures precise voltage regulation over a wide temperature range.
- Low Power Consumption: The device operates with a very low quiescent current, making it suitable for battery-powered applications where power efficiency is crucial.
- Wide Operating Current Range: The LM4041DQDBZT can operate over a broad current range from 45 µA to 10 mA, providing versatility in various circuit configurations.
- Stable Reverse Breakdown Voltage: The reverse breakdown voltage is stable and precise, which is vital for accurate and reliable voltage reference in electronic circuits.
- Small Package: Available in a small SOT-23 package, the LM4041DQDBZT is ideal for space-constrained applications.
